Roof Reshingling Questions
What is roof reshingling? Roof reshingling involves replacing old or damaged shingles to restore the roof’s appearance and protection.
When should a roof be reshingled? Reshingling is recommended when shingles are cracked, curled, or missing, and the roof shows signs of wear.
What types of shingles are available? Common options include asphalt, architectural, and specialty shingles, each offering different durability and styles.
How does reshingling improve a property? Reshingling enhances curb appeal and provides better protection against weather elements.
